Build requirements / compilation using CMake

On Debian based systems this would mean that the following packages have to be installed:

apt-get install build-essential gcc make cmake cmake-gui cmake-curses-gui

Also, in order to build a debian package from the source code, the following packages have to be installed

apt-get install fakeroot fakeroot devscripts dh-make lsb-release

Ninja can be downloaded from its github project page in the "releases" section. Optionally it is possible to build binaries with SSL support. This requires the OpenSSL libraries and includes to be available. E. g. on Debian:

apt-get install libssl-dev

The documentation requires doxygen and optionally graphviz:

apt-get install doxygen graphviz
